Julia Irene Quick, 97, of 2520 Botsford
Ave., Altoona, passed away Friday, June 18, 2010, at Luther
Hospital in Eau Claire.

Julia was born Sept. 9th, 1912, in Blabon, ND to
Alfred and Louise Evenson. She was raised in Aneta, ND until the
age of 17 when they moved to Eau Claire. Julie married Fredrick
Quick in 1935. She worked many jobs, but the longest was the 20
years she worked as a night cook with the Syverson Home until the
age of 72. She loved to sing and play the piano. But most of all,
she loved spending time with her family and great grand children.
